The TCAN1044VDDFR is a high-performance CAN FD (Controller Area Network Flexible Data-Rate) transceiver from Texas Instruments, designed to serve as an interface between a CAN protocol controller and the physical two-wire CAN bus. This device is suitable for automotive applications and industrial automation systems, providing reliable data transmission at data rates exceeding classical CAN limits.
Key Features
- Compatibility: The transceiver is compliant with the ISO 11898-2:2016 standard and supports both CAN FD and classic CAN communication protocols.
- Data Rates: It enables data rates up to 5 Mbps for CAN FD, ensuring efficient communication in systems requiring higher bandwidth.
- Protection: The device offers robust protection features, including bus fault protection to ±58V, and is designed to withstand the harsh conditions of automotive environments.
- Low Power Mode: An ultra-low power mode with a remote wake-up feature helps reduce overall power consumption of the system.
- Thermal Protection: Thermal shutdown protection ensures that the device remains safe under extreme operating conditions.

Package and Quality
The TCAN1044VDDFR is offered in a 14-pin SOIC package, making it easy to integrate into existing designs. The device is also AEC-Q100 qualified, ensuring automotive-grade quality and reliability.
